...in one easy workflow

Define top-level specifications

The co-pilot assists you to define necessary product requirements and supply chain criteria

Review the functional breakdown

The co-pilot engineers the hierarchical functions and sub-functions and their requirements - all the way down to parts-level

Review the BOM

The co-pilot generates your BOM, not only taking into account the functional requirements but also your compliance needs and supply chain criteria

Change requests? Iterate your BOM with the new requirements
